Understanding the Core Gameplay Mechanics
At its heart, the chicken road game is remarkably straightforward. The primary objective is to guide the chicken across a road filled with vehicles traveling at varying speeds. Players typically control the chicken’s movement with simple taps or clicks, prompting it to move forward. The challenge stems from precisely timing these movements to avoid collisions with the vehicles. Successfully reaching the opposite side earns the player points, and the difficulty increases as the game progresses, introducing faster cars and more frequent traffic. It requires quick thinking and adaptation.
A key element to mastering the game is recognizing patterns in the traffic flow. While the game introduces randomness, observant players can often predict when it’s safe to make a move. Successfully navigating the road isn’t merely about reaction time but about anticipating the movements of the vehicles, making calculated risks, and learning from each attempt. It’s a simple concept, but it quickly becomes addictive.

Strategies for Improving Your Score
While the chicken road game relies heavily on reflexes, there are several strategies players can employ to improve their scores. Firstly, patience is crucial. Avoid rushing into gaps that are too small or appear risky. Waiting for a clear opening will significantly increase your chances of success. Secondly, pay attention to the speed of the vehicles. Faster cars require more precise timing, while slower cars offer more forgiving windows for crossing. Recognizing these differences will help you make more informed decisions.
Furthermore, learning to anticipate the movement of vehicles is key. Observing the patterns of traffic flow allows players to predict when gaps will appear and prepare accordingly. Practicing regularly is also essential, as it helps improve reaction time and build muscle memory. The more you play, the more naturally the timing will come.
